When Chill Becomes Crisis: Understanding Xanax Withdrawal Symptoms

Xanax is a frequently utilized medication used to manage anxiety and panic disorders. While it can be highly effective in managing these conditions, abrupt cessation of Xanax use can lead to severe withdrawal symptoms. These symptoms can be unpleasant, ranging from mild anxiety to more dangerous effects like seizures or delirium. Understanding the potential for Xanax withdrawal is crucial for individuals who are considering discontinuing their medication. It's essential to discuss a medical professional to develop a effective withdrawal plan that minimizes discomfort and possible complications.

The Xanax Dilemma: Balancing Anxiety Relief with Potential Side Effects

Xanax, a widely prescribed medication for anxiety disorders, presents a complex dilemma. While it can effectively reduce symptoms of panic and worry, its use also carries the risk of negative side effects. Users who rely on Xanax must carefully weigh the benefits against these potential consequences. Long-term use can lead to dependence and discomfort symptoms when discontinuing the medication.

To mitigate risks, it is crucial to consult a healthcare professional to determine the appropriate dosage and duration of treatment. They can assess your response to Xanax and change the regimen as needed. , Furthermore, exploring different treatment options, such as therapy or lifestyle modifications, can contribute to a comprehensive approach to anxiety management.
